POSITION SPECIFICS
Your working location can/will be fully on-site located in State College, Pennsylvania.
We are searching for a proactive and technically curious Scientific Computing Engagement Specialist to join the Applied Sustainment Technologies Division at the Applied Research Laboratory (ARL) at Penn State. The Applied Sustainment Technologies Division builds technologies that enable the autonomic nervous system of defense sustainment from smart assets and systems to a responsive enterprise. This role will support the development, integration, and maintenance of software and scientific computing solutions used across ARL research programs. You will work with engineers, researchers, programmers, and other technical personnel to develop practical software solutions, troubleshoot technical problems, and support research computing and system integration activities.
ARL is an authorized DoD SkillBridge partner and welcomes all transitioning military members to apply.
You will:
Support integration of software with research computing platforms, hardware, embedded systems, sensors, databases, networks, and other technical systems
Troubleshoot software, computing environment, system integration, and application performance issues
Assist with installation, configuration, and maintenance of software development and scientific computing environments
Collaborate with engineers, researchers, programmers, and technical staff to translate research requirements into practical computing solutions
Participate in software testing, verification, validation, documentation, and configuration-management activities
Research and evaluate new programming languages, computing tools, libraries, frameworks, and emerging technologies that may improve research capabilities
Provide technical support and guidance to researchers and other users of computing resources
Required Skills/Experience areas include:
Troubleshoot software and technical system problems methodically
Experience collaborating in multi-disciplinary, team-oriented cultures
Ability to communicate technical information successfully and provide effective support to technical users
Past success using one or more programming or scripting languages and the ability to learn additional technologies as project needs evolve
Preferred Skills/Experience areas include:
C, C++, C#, Python, Java, JavaScript, .NET, SQL, or similar programming languages
Linux and/or Windows computing and software-development environments
Scientific computing, data processing, automation, databases, networking, APIs, embedded systems, or hardware/software integration
Git or other version-control and configuration-management tools
Exposure to high-performance computing, cloud computing, virtualization, containers, AI/ML, or other advanced computing technologies
Current eligibility for access to classified information at the Secret level or higher and may be subject to a government background investigation to upgrade clearance eligibility, if required
MINIMUM EDUCATION, WORK EXPERIENCE & REQUIRED CERTIFICATIONS
Associate Degree 2+ years of relevant experience; or an equivalent combination of education and experience accepted Required Certifications: None
